Property Description
The property has been extended to the side and rear, creating a perfect balance of character and modern living. As you enter through the covered porch, you are welcomed by a bright entrance hall with access to all ground-floor rooms. At the front of the house are two separate reception rooms: a cosy study featuring a charming wood-burning stove with a tiled hearth, and a versatile sitting room that can double as a guest bedroom.
To the rear, the highlight of the home is the stunning open-plan kitchen/dining/family room. This beautifully designed space is bathed in natural light, thanks to large skylights and bi-fold doors that open onto the garden. The modern kitchen offers an extensive range of wall and base units, complemented by high-quality worktops and integrated appliances. The dining area provides ample space for family meals, while the adjoining sitting area creates a sociable and relaxed atmosphere, perfect for entertaining.
Adjacent to the kitchen is a spacious utility room with additional storage, plumbing for appliances, and a tiled floor that continues into the convenient downstairs cloakroom with WC.
A split staircase leads to the first floor, where two separate landing areas give access to the bedrooms and bathrooms. The principal bedroom is a generous double room with dual-aspect windows offering lovely views towards Limpsfield Church. Across the landing is a modern shower room, complete with a heated towel rail and tiled flooring.
The second double bedroom, located to the left of the staircase, features a built-in double wardrobe and views over the front garden. The third bedroom, situated at the rear of the house, is a good-sized single room with views overlooking the rear garden. Completing the first floor is a well-appointed family bathroom.
There is a large, boarded loft space, with two pull-down ladders and lighting, providing excellent additional storage.
Outside
The rear garden is a standout feature of this property. A large patio area, perfect for outdoor dining and entertaining, leads up to a well-maintained lawn bordered by mature hedges for privacy. A block-paved pathway winds its way to the end of the garden, where you’ll find a large garden office/gym, wooden playhouse and a garden shed. The front of the property is attractively screened by hedging and features a driveway with parking for several vehicles, alongside a lawned area and flower beds.
Location
Granville Road is a popular residential street within walking distance of Oxted’s vibrant town centre. Oxted station provides regular mainline services to East Croydon and London Bridge, with journey times of approximately 40 minutes, making this an ideal location for commuters. The town offers a fantastic range of amenities, including a Leisure Complex with a swimming pool and cinema, as well as a variety of shops, cafes, and restaurants. Both Waitrose and Morrisons are conveniently located nearby, ensuring all your shopping needs are met. Junction 6 of the M25 is just 3 miles away, providing easy access to Gatwick Airport and central London.
For families, the area is well-served by excellent local schools. State options include Limpsfield and Downs Way Infant Schools, St Mary’s Junior School, and Oxted Secondary School. Independent schools in the area include the highly regarded Hazelwood School, all within approximately a mile of the property.
